She passed again! Whew!!

The HC reading was higher at idle that I would like (349ppm - max 400ppm) but I think that was due to idling off an on in line for 40 minutes. Everything else was clean.

Good for another year.

ljdavick wrote on Wed, 05 January 2011 18:57



Wait a minute - Arizona requires a smog check on a '73???



And people complain about California!




Yep and unlike cars that are driven thousands of miles every year which are tested every 2 years, a motorhome which might be drive a couple hundred miles per year in the counties that require emissions testing, is EVERY year.
